Output 23f62ec081b02e26e4a6da086b4320dac3cb521dd717ec1c05ead4fff8afdcbb:7

value
764599
script pubkey
OP_0 OP_PUSHBYTES_20 bc8d5a4588a95fb6c94434c83e48d4a2414baf49
address
bc1qhjx453vg490mdj2yxnyrujx55fq5ht6fdvfgqq
transaction
23f62ec081b02e26e4a6da086b4320dac3cb521dd717ec1c05ead4fff8afdcbb